Position Overview

We are seeking a skilled Board Certified / Board Eligible OBGYN physician to join our Westside Medical Center team in Hillsboro, Oregon. Our ideal candidate will have a strong passion for women's health and the ability to provide high-quality, comprehensive care. Joining an integrated and compassionate team of physicians, nurse midwives, rotating OBGYN and Family Medicine residents and supportive clinical and administrative staff, you will provide a mix of both obstetrics and gynecology services while enjoying 24/7 backup on the L&D unit with dedicated on-site anesthesia and pediatric services, a nursery with the ability to care for neonates 35 weeks and older, and an average of 120 deliveries per month.

Our OBGYN Physicians Can Also Expect To

  • Share call coverage
  • Work within a highly skilled, collegial, and dedicated team with a patient-centered approach to care
  • Have access to an advanced Epic EMR and virtual scribe service
Working For Northwest Permanente, Our OBGYN Physicians Enjoy

$311,000 to $404,000 – Projected Annual Total Rewards Value
*
  • Salary: $246,240 to $300,330 prorated to 0.9 FTE
  • 21% employer contribution to retirement programs, including pension (This is not a match; NWP contributes an additional 21% of clinician earnings to retirement programs regardless of employee contribution)
  • 90%+ employer paid health plan
  • Paid annual education leave + $1.8K annual education allowance
  • Public Service Loan Forgiveness (PSLF) eligible
In addition to Projected Annual Total Rewards value, New Hire Incentives include:
  • Relocation allowance - up to $15K
  • Generous sign-on bonus - $25K

Join Our Medical Group

Northwest Permanente is a self-governed, physician-led, multi-specialty group of 1,500 physicians, surgeons, and clinicians, caring for 630,000 members in Oregon and Southwest Washington. Kaiser Permanente is one of the nation's preeminent health care systems, a benchmark for comprehensive, integrated, value-based, and high-quality care.
